Passive - A Thousand Cuts
Description:
Gwen's attacks deal bonus magic damage based on the targets health. She heals for a portion of the damage dealt to champions by this effect.
Use:
Well, the use of this passive is more or less just to use your Q (
Snip snip!) and R (
Needlework) wisely.
General Info:
Gwen's attacks will deal an additional Max Health magic damage (1% + 0.008% AP) on hit. She will also be able to recover health equivalent to 70% of the damage that this ability will deal to her opponents.

Q - Snip Snip!
Description:
Gwen snips her scissors in a cone up to 6 times dealing magic damage. Gwen deals true damage to units in the center and applies
A Thousand Cuts to them on each snip.
Use:
Basically, Gwen's
Q is your main damage source. You use it for wave-clearing and trading. But if you want to freeze your wave, be wary not to hit unnecessary other minions, because the range is quite broad - even for scissors. Also, if you go for trades, make sure to hit the enemy with the center - that true damage really hurts and also applies
A Thousand Cuts to them, so your healing is very impressive and can often turn a whole fight to your favor.
General Info:
Mana: 40
Cooldown scaling: 6.5/5.75/5/4.25/3.5s
Passive:
Gwen will gain 1 stack while hitting an opponent with any of her attacks (max 4, lasts for 6 seconds).
Active:
It will consume stacks. Gwen will snip once for [8/10.75/13.5/16.25/19 +5% AP] magic damage, snip again for each ammo consumed, and snip for a final time for [40/53.75/67.5/81.25/95 +25% AP] magic damage. The center of each strike will deal true damage instead and apply Gwen's Passive (
A Thousand Cuts) to hit enemies. The max damage will be 80, plus [600% +4.8% AP)% percent health.

W - Hallowed Mist
Description:
Gwen summons mist that protects her from enemies outside of it. She can only be targeted by enemies who enter the mist.
Use:
Activate when getting to ranged enemies like ADCs. Also, if you fight in lane, use it to simply get armor and magic resist. You can also run through Zoe's E (
Sleepy Trouble Bubble) without actually proccing her bubble for example. Such is for any kind of cc where the source champ is outside your
W.
General Info:
Mana: 60
Cooldown: 22/20/18/16/14s
Hallowed Mist will make Gwen untargetable to all enemies (except towers) for 5 seconds or until she leaves it. While inside the Mist, Gwen will gain [20 + 5% AP] Armor, along with Magic Resist. Gwen will also be able to recast this ability once in order to call the Mist to her. The recasting will happen automatically when she attempts to leave the zone for the first time.

E - Skip 'n Slash
Description:
Gwen dashes a short distance then gains attack speed, attack range, and on-hit magic damage for a few seconds. If she hits an enemy during that time, this Ability's cooldown is partially refunded.
Use:
This is a Gap-Closer. So how do you use it? Well there are a few methods. You can initiate an engage, you can chase someone off much easier, and most important: Use it to dodge enemy cc. Irelia's E (
Flawless Duet) for example. If she stands in your
W you have to dodge it anyhow, and that's where your
E comes in handy.
General Info:
Mana: 35
Cooldown: 13/12/11/10/9s
Gwen will be able to dash one time and empower her attacks for 4 seconds. Empowered Attacks will gain 40/50/60/70/80% Attack Speed, [10 +8% AP] on hit magic damage and 100 range. The first one to hit an enemy will also refund 50% of this ability's cooldown.

R - Needlework
Description:
Gwen hurls a needle that slows enemies hit, deals magic damage, and applies
A Thousand Cuts to champions hit.
This ability can be cast up to two more times, with each cast throwing additional needles and dealing more damage. Gwen must hit an enemy between each cast to unlock the next one.
Use:
Use it to get close to enemies in combination with your
E. Once reached the enemy, you must make sure to hit every needle possible. That damage and healing is not to be underestimated. Like your
Q, it's for sustain. The more needles you hit, the more healing you recieve. Also, your lvl 6 is your powerspike to actually put pressure onto your opponent. In general, every engage post 6 should not be done without your
R up. (If you're fed it's a whole other situation)
General Info:
Mana: 100
Cooldown: 120/100/80s
Gwen can cast her ult up to three times in one go.
First Cast: Gwen will launch a single needle dealing [30/55/80 +8% AP] magic damage to the enemy champions. It will slow down by 40/50/60% for 1.5 seconds and will apply AA to all enemies. If she attacks an enemy within 6 seconds of casting R, she will be able to recast it 2 more times.
Second Cast: Launch three needles to deal [3x Base Damage] magic damage.
Third Cast: Launch five needles to deal [5x Base Damage] magic damage.
Successive needles hitting the same unit will slow down by 15/20/25%. The maximum damage for Gwen's R will be [9x Base Damage], plus [9% +0.072% AP]% max health damage from her AA.

How to play: Toplane Laningphase
So Toplane is Gwen's standard lane. She's a AP Bruiser and therefore well made for that position.
The Laningphase:
It's hard to actually do anything pre 6, but you can try to force flash or win a early trade if you hit lvl 2 before your opponent. Skill E (
Skip 'n Slash) second and jump to your enemy. Make a use of your Q wisely and see what happens. You can outtrade him with an AA-Battle too because of your Passive (
A Thousand Cuts).
Post 6:
If you hit your level 6 before your oponnent, you can instantly go for an engage. Skill your R (
Needlework), and use it instantly to slow your enemy. Go in for that
Q or AAs with your
E. Don't forget to recast your R if you hit an enemy minion or champion! You will noticed that you regain extremely much health because of your
Passive proccs on your
Needles and
Qs.
Farming is very important (as always), but you need certain items to simply blow up the enemy turrets. Once you reach a tower, make use of your
E and cut that tower down.

How to play: Toplane Midgame
Midgame:
Go for at least 7-8 cs/min. Push your enemy into his tower and get as much towerdamage done as you can. Also, choose your items carefully on your team's needs!
If a teamfight is going to break out, tell your teammates to try to stall and splitpush as hard as you can. (
Yorick wants to know your location btw.)

How to play: Toplane Lategame
Lategame:
Your goal is to at least splitpush Toplane and Midlane to their inhib. If you successfully managed to do so, you can splitpush toplane and instantly TP bot to try to get their base damaged. It's lategame so they will at least have to get 2 guys to stop you from destroying their entire lifes.
Teamfighting is an option too, but you're better off at splitpushing. If a TeamFight breaks out, go for the backline. The combination of your
Q and
R allows you to heal enough to sustain the damage of at least the ADC.

Midlane: AP Assassin?!
No, you're not really an AP Assassin like
LeBlanc but you actually have tons of damage in your kit. You got 4 spells scaling well with AP, not exactly oneshotting, but dealing massive damage. If you go Night Harvester, you might surprise the ADC with your damage output. The rest of the game is as simple as playing Toplane, but try to focus more on teamfighting and objective-control.
The best Matchups for you on Midlane are:
Yasuo,
Akali and
Kassadin in my opinion, because you can outtrade all of them if you play it well enough with your E and Q everytime. If Akali is in her shroud: Simply
Q in the directions you believe she is. Same goes for
R.
Worst Matchups are
LeBlanc for example. That lanebully does not allow you to farm nor trade. You can't even make good use of your
W because she just dashes into it. Ask your jungler for help and stay safe!

Jungle: Cutting Trees?
Well actually, you can say that you're snipping trees, but it's a bit more complicated. First I tried to Solo-Start
Raptors with
Emberknife, but forget that idea. Start
Hailblade and RedbuffRedbuff, let the bot- or toplane have you get a leash, and do
Krugs afterwards.
You can then look for a gank on top/bot or mid, or simply do
Raptors or go to the other side of the jungle. If you got enough time to do
Wolves and BluebuffBluebuff before the
Rift-Scuttler spawns, then do so, and afterwards look for a gank on top/bot or mid again. If you run out of time before the spawn of the
Scuttle-Crab, look that you finish off your current camp and beat that pacifist to the ground.
With
Berserker's and
Nash's you don't need to worry about clearing your camps. You got enough damage and attack speed.
Ganking:
In terms of ganking, prefer lanes with higher cc rate. You don't have any cc up your sleeves, so it's really hard to gank those without any cc themselves. Also: Don't be afraid to take kills. You can be the one of the carries in your team, if you want. But if you see your
Vayne doing extremely good, let her get that kill.<3 (Otherwise you might get flamed all game long...)
Counter Jungling:
